Firstly, purely for location, drink and the Team, I would give this place 5 stars easily. It has to be one of the best locations in Portsmouth. What a view!! I can’t think of a better place to have a Beer. (Other than back home in Cornwall).However, the food slightly let it down.I had a Burger, it was good, but in this day and age, Burgers can easily be made epic and it was just ordinary. The “Secret Sauce” essentially a cross between American Mustard and Mayo with a subtle hint of Spice. I just felt it could be better for nearly £15. Comparing it to something like Byron or Honest, if they score a 7 or 8 out of 10, then this is 5 at best.Mum had the Chicken Kiev. And while the chicken itself was proper juicy, the breadcrumb was a little greasy/oily and the Mash it came with, almost liquid from the Butter. (You can see the pool of Butter in the Pic) Complimented by just a Teaspoon of over wilted Spinach.As I say, it wasn’t bad at all. It was okay Pub Food. What I’d expect from your average village local. But I’ve eaten in some great Pubs that do really great food. And this was just ordinary with no wow factor I’m afraid. Some careless food mistakes that could very easily be rectified to turn it into a stunning 5/5 all round venue.Chips and the Beer…Location and Staff, yeah they all get a 5/5.
